What affects the price

Wildlife removal costs aren't one-size-fits-all because every property is different. The final bill depends on the type of animal you’re dealing with, how long they’ve been inside, and the specific entry points they’ve chewed through. If the critter has created a nest in a hard-to-reach attic or caused structural damage, repairs will naturally increase the labor required. We also consider the complexity of the trapping plan and the number of follow-up visits needed to ensure the problem stays solved.

As autumn arrives, wildlife begins preparing for the coming winter. Animals are busy gathering food and fortifying their dens, which often brings them into closer contact with your home’s perimeter. Inspecting your rooflines, vents, and foundation now can prevent a major infestation before the first freeze forces these animals to move indoors for long-term shelter.

What's the 3-3-3 rule for animals?

The 3-3-3 rule is a guideline used for assessing the adjustment period for newly adopted animals, particularly dogs, in a new environment. It suggests that it takes about three days for an animal to decompress, three weeks to learn routines, and three months to feel truly at home.
